• /
  • EnglishEspañolFrançais日本語한국어Português
  • Se connecterDémarrer

Cette traduction automatique est fournie pour votre commodité.

En cas d'incohérence entre la version anglaise et la version traduite, la version anglaise prévaudra. Veuillez visiter cette page pour plus d'informations.

Créer un problème

Paquet Python instrumenté

Ce document répertorie les packages et modules automatiquement instrumentés par l'Python agent après son installation . Vous pouvez également utiliser une instrumentation personnalisée si vous souhaitez :

  • Désactivez instrumentation pour un package ou des modules spécifiques si l' instrumentation interfère avec votre application.
  • Instrumenter un package ou module tiers qui n'est pas instrumenté automatiquement par l' agent.
  • Ajoutez une instrumentation plus spécifique à votre propre code, par exemple pour suivre le temps passé dans des fonctions supplémentaires.

Pour demander instrumentation intégrée pour un package supplémentaire, obtenez de l'aide sur support.newrelic.com.

Frameworks Web

services back-end

Rendu du modèle

Frameworks GraphQL

L'agent Python fournit des informations détaillées sur GraphQL application les opérations et les résolveurs de votre et rapporte GraphQLles métriques et les attributs span spécifiques . Pour plus d'informations sur la dénomination des transactions et d'autres fonctionnalités, veuillez consulter notre documentationGraphQL . À partir de la version 6.10.0.165 agent, l' agent prend en charge le framework GraphQL suivant :

Détails de l'instance

L' agent collecte les détailsinstance pour une variété de bases de données et de pilotes de base de données. La possibilité d'afficher une instance spécifique et les types d'informations de base de données dépend de la Python agent version de votre .

L'agent Python version 2.72.0.52 ou supérieure prend en charge les éléments suivants :

base de données

Nom du package Python

Version minimale du package

Version minimale de l'agent

PostgreSQL

psycopg

3.0

9.11.0

PostgreSQL

psycopg2

2.0.14

2.72.0.52

MySQL

MySQLdb

1.2.5

2.74.0.54

Redis

redis

2.6.2

2.74.0.54

Redis

Arède

1.1.4

7.6.0.173

Redis

aioredis

1.3.1

7.14.0.177

Memcached

memcached-python

1.51

2.76.0.55

aiomcache

aiomcache

0.8.2

9.12.0

Elasticsearch

elasticsearch

0,45

2.78.0.56

Pour demander des informations au niveau de l'instance à partir de magasins de données actuellement non répertoriés pour votre agent, obtenez de l'aide sur support.newrelic.com.

Adaptateurs de base de données SQL

Pour les modules compatibles Python DB-API 2.0 répertoriés dans cette section, l'agent Python prend en charge :

  • Moment de requête de base de données
  • Capture SQL pour la requête de base de données
  • Capture d'une trace d'appels pour une requête longue de base de données
  • MySQL et PostgreSQ uniquement : la capture explique les plans pour une requête de base de données lente

L'agent Python doit être capable de suivre les requêtes de base de données pour tous les Python API modules compatibles DB- 2.0. Cependant, l'agent Python ne prend officiellement en charge que les modules répertoriés dans cette section.

Pour les adaptateurs de base de données suivants, nous fournissons instrumentation supplémentaire pour les fonctionnalités en dehors de la spécification DB-API 2.0, telles que des méthodes de raccourci pour exécuter une requête sans créer de curseurs :

Si votre module client de base de données n'est pas répertorié dans cette section, obtenez de l'aide sur support.newrelic.com. Le support New Relic pourra peut-être suggérer une modification temporaire de votre fichier de configuration pour le faire fonctionner.

Clients de base de données NoSQL

Le timing des appels effectués sur la base de données NoSQL est fourni pour les modules clients suivants.

Clients Elasticsearch

Le temps passé dans les appels effectués vers Elasticsearch sera répertorié à la fois dans le graphique d'aperçu principal, ainsi que dans l'onglet base de données de l' UI.

Clients Memcache

La synchronisation des memcache requests et la capture du type de requête sont fournies pour les memcache modules clients suivants.

Clients du service Solr

Le calendrier des de Solr service requests et le type de demande sont fournis pour les Solr modules clients suivants.

Clients du courtier en messages

La synchronisation des transactions du courtier de messages est fournie pour les modules suivants.

Services Web externes

La synchronisation des requests services Web externes est effectuée via les modules suivants.

Modèles d'apprentissage automatique et LLM

Droits d'auteur © 2025 New Relic Inc.

This site is protected by reCAPTCHA and the Google Privacy Policy and Terms of Service apply.